    That was really cool Gibs, and enlightening!

    edit! And I meant to ask, how come you use a square brush? I cannot comprehend how you use that and render your tones in such a smooth manner.

    I use a rounded square brush because I find it gives a better "paintbrush" feel then a rounded brush. It's set to change direction when I paint, so the square rotates around.
